Although less glamorous, the single-shot Harrington and Richardson (H&R) shotgun may arguably be one of the simplest and most prominent firearms to grace American hunting …Harrington & Richardson, located in Worcester, Massachusetts, was founded in 1871 by Gilbert H. Harrington, the inventor of the top-break revolver, and William A. Richardson. By 1876, H&R had become sufficiently established to be represented at the National Centennial Exposition in Philadelphia, where the company exhibited 24 of its pistols.

Model No. 1-1/2. A .32-caliber spur-trigger single-action revolver, with 2.5" octagonal barrel and 5-shot cylinder. Nickel-plated, round-butt rubber grips with an "H&R" emblem molded in. Approximately 10,000 manufactured between 1878 and 1883. Gun Type: Handgun. Antique. Excellent $0000. Fine $0000. Very Good $0000. Nov 19, 2023 · Harrington & Richardson (H&R) Firearms, founded in 1871, played a crucial role in American firearm history. Initially known for producing inexpensive revolvers, H&R gained prominence with their break-top, top-ejecting revolvers. In the 20th century, they expanded their product line to include shotguns, rifles, and single-shot firearms.

A stainless steel grill can be the perfect addition to your outdoor space. The first step in incorpor...The Harrington & Richardson Model 949 "Forty Niner" were made from 1961 to 1972. The 9-shot double action revolvers were fitted with a 5 1/2 inch barrel, windage adjustable rear sight, smooth walnut grips, side load and western style ejection, full blue finished, and chambered in .22 LR. C ...Harrington & Richardson, located in Worcester, Massachusetts, was founded in 1871 by Gilbert H. Harrington, the inventor of the top-break revolver, and William A. Richardson. By 1876, H&R had become sufficiently established to be represented at the National Centennial Exposition in Philadelphia, where the company exhibited 24 of its pistols.
